NYS Adults
Those who support this process say it makes us more independent from foreign oil and creates jobs. Those who oppose this process say it contaminates community water supplies and the environment. Which do you think is more important:
Creating jobs Preserving water supplies and the environment Unsure
Row % Row % Row %
NYS Adults 41% 51% 8%
Region New York City 40% 51% 9%
Suburbs 46% 44% 10%
Upstate 40% 55% 6%
Income Less $50,000 46% 47% 7%
$50,000 to just under $100,000 39% 52% 9%
$100,000 or more 38% 56% 6%
Income Less than $50,000 46% 47% 7%
$50,000 or more 39% 53% 8%
Education Not college graduate 45% 48% 7%
College graduate 35% 57% 8%
Age Under 45 39% 55% 6%
45 or older 44% 47% 9%
Age 18 to 29 39% 57% 4%
30 to 44 40% 54% 7%
45 to 59 41% 50% 9%
60 or older 47% 42% 10%
Generation Millennials (18-30) 37% 58% 4%
Gen X (31-46) 44% 50% 6%
Baby Boomers (47-65) 38% 53% 9%
Silent-Greatest (Over 65) 51% 37% 12%
Race White 41% 51% 8%
Non White 43% 49% 8%
Gender Men 42% 51% 7%
Women 40% 51% 9%
Interview Type Landline 39% 52% 9%
Cell Phone 49% 47% 4%
NY1/YNN-Marist Poll NYS Adults: Interviews conducted July 28th through July 31st, 2011, N=600 MOE +/- 4%. Totals may not add to 100 due to rounding.
